What Are Inner Ear Monitors?

A Brief History

Inner ear monitors, also known as in-ear monitors or IEMs, made their debut in the 1980s. They were initially developed as a solution to the challenges faced by musicians on stage, such as poor audio quality and inadequate monitoring.

The Basic Components

An inner ear monitor consists of three primary components: the earpiece, the cable, and the connector. The earpiece is designed to fit snugly within the ear canal, providing a comfortable yet secure fit for extended periods.

Why Musicians Love Them

Sound Isolation

One of the key reasons why musicians gravitate towards inner ear monitors is their exceptional ability to isolate external noise. This isolation allows performers to focus solely on their music without being distracted by ambient sounds or stage noise.

Personalized Audio Mix

Another compelling feature of inner ear monitors is their capability to deliver a personalized audio mix directly to each musician. This means that every band member can have a customized blend of instruments and vocals tailored to their preferences, ensuring an optimal performance experience for everyone on stage.

How Wireless In Ear Monitors Work

The Technology Explained

Wireless in-ear monitors operate using radio frequency (RF) or digital signals to transmit audio from the sound system directly to the earpieces worn by the musicians. This wireless technology enables seamless mobility without compromising audio quality, providing a reliable and consistent monitoring experience.

Maintaining Sound Quality

Despite being wireless, modern in-ear monitor systems are engineered to uphold uncompromised sound fidelity. Advanced signal processing and transmission technologies ensure minimal latency and interference, preserving the integrity of the audio signal from source to earpiece.

The Role of Drivers in IEM Audio

Single vs. Multiple Drivers

In-ear monitors utilize miniature speakers known as drivers to convert electrical signals into sound waves. These drivers can be categorized as either single-driver or multiple-driver configurations, each with its own set of characteristics and advantages.

Single-driver IEMs integrate all sound frequencies into a single driver, offering a cohesive and balanced audio output. On the other hand, multiple-driver IEMs allocate specific frequency ranges to individual drivers, resulting in enhanced clarity and separation of instruments and vocals.

Custom Molds vs. Universal Fit

When considering in-ear monitor options, individuals encounter a choice between custom-molded earpieces tailored to their unique ear anatomy or universal-fit earpieces designed to accommodate a broader range of users. Custom molds offer unparalleled comfort and noise isolation by conforming precisely to the contours of the ear canal, while universal-fit options provide convenience and accessibility to a wider audience.

The Importance of Seal

Irrespective of whether one opts for custom molds or universal-fit earpieces, achieving an airtight seal within the ear canal is crucial for maximizing sound isolation and bass response. A secure seal not only prevents external noise from infiltrating but also ensures that the full spectrum of audio frequencies is faithfully delivered to the listener’s ears.
